About This Item

1995 3 Maps. 30 Illus. 560 Pages. 15 x 23cms. Good in D/W. The major submarine campaigns of Allied & Axis Submarines during WW2. The experience of submarine & anti-submarine warfare from the decision makers to the crews beneath the seas. 3 appendices including chronology. References & notes. Index. Biblio.
